I am looking for a bit of advice regarding my selection of an external Matrox external graphic expander box.

Monitor wise, I have access to 3 x Dell U2311H 23" Monitors (1920x1080).
http://accessories.us.dell.com/sna/productdetail.aspx?c=us&cs=19&l=en&sku=320-9270

The work machine I will use with the monitors is an original 2008 MacBook Pro with a Dual-Link DVI output and a NVidia GeForce 8600GT video card (512mb).

The Matrox site states on this page (http://www.matrox.com/graphics/en/products/gxm/mac/choice/) that the best solution for a triple monitor setup for this Mac is a Matrox TripleHead2Go Digital Edition (T2G-D3D-IF).

My only reservation is this machine may be upgraded to a newer MacBookPro sometime next year. The newest MacBookPro has a Mini Display Port (opposed to a Dual-Link DVI which my present Mac has), and in this case, Matrox advise to use a TripleHead2Go DP Edition (T2G-DP-MIF).

To future proof myself, I am wondering if I can use the newer DP Edition on my 2008 MacBookPro using some sort of Dual-Link-DVI to Mini-Display-Port adapter? If so, will resolution and / or quality of output be effected in any way?

The Matrox box is not that cheap so I want to make sure I get this right before purchasing.

I had a DisplayPort MacBook Pro working with a DisplayPort TripleHead2Go working with 2 screens at 1920 x 1200 when running BootCamp quite successfully but could never get it to work with the DVi model even with Apple's Mini DisplayPort -> DVI convertor. Check the reviews on Apple's & Amazon Website and you'll find loads for complaints.
